So I ran accross Bill Rosinski's email address the other day (He's a realtor in Charlotte) and decided to drop a line and thank him for the decade we all spent listening. His response:

I can't thank you enough for your kind words. Even though this will be the fifth season since my final broadcast I always appreciate it when fans, like you, tell me they enjoyed my ten years with the team. I have been lucky enough to stay involved doing the NFL on Westwood One but just last month I signed on with ESPN Radio to be thier voice of college football and basketball. This will be the first time in about 20 years that I have not done the NFL for some network or team but it was a move that made sense for a number of reasons. I will still be involved doing the ACC as well and even picked up some golf on the radio with the PGA Tour. As I wrote in the book, Panthers fans are criticised for being a little laid back but I can tell you that the reaction when the team let me go is something my family and I will never forget. Hope all is well in your world and once again thanks for the note.

Bill Rosinski
